npm Documentation
This is the documentation for
https://docs.npmjs.com/.
This repository contains the
content for our documentation site, and the GitHub Actions workflows
that generate the site itself.
Quick start
npm installto download gatsby, our theme, and the dependenciesnpm run develop: starts the test server athttp://localhost:8000.- Update the content - it's Mdx, which is like markdown - in the
content
directory. - Review your content at
http://localhost:8000. (Gatsby watches the
filesystem and will reload your content changes immediately.) - Once you're happy, commit it and open a pull request at
https://github.com/npm/documentation. - A CI workflow run will publish your PR to the staging documentation
site at https://docs-staging.npmjs.com/. - Once the content is reviewed, merge the pull request. That will
deploy the site.

Theme
The gatsby theme used here is "doctornpm" - a variation of
doctocat with some theme changes
for npm's design language and additional components to support multiple
versions of the CLI documentation.
